Key Airports
Bordeaux–Mérignac Airport (BOD) serves as the primary international gateway for the Aquitaine region of France. It is well-equipped for cargo operations, featuring modern facilities and efficient logistics services.
London Stansted Airport (STN) is one of the major airports serving London and is a significant hub for air freight. It offers excellent connectivity and a range of services to handle various types of cargo.

What documents are needed for France to United Kingdom?
Key documents include a commercial invoice, air waybill, export declaration, and any necessary import permits or licenses.
